South Sound Kids’ Calendar for April 28th-May 3rd!

April 28, 2013 by Maegen Blue

Need something to do with the kids in Tacoma, Puyallup, Auburn, Olympia, or your part of the South Sound?

Here’s a whole list of family events and activities right around here.

Here’s a special edition of my weekday guide with, “All Week,” ideas at the top, followed by a daily dose of fun.

Other Weekday Events and Fun

Monday

Military Monday at Discovery Village in Gig Harbor  Special discount for members of the military

El Dia De Los Ninos at the Auburn Library  Special story time and multi cultural celebration for preschoolers celebrating the International Day of the Child 11:15  Scroll to the date for the listing; I regret that I can’t seem to link to individual events in the KCLS.

Indoor Toddler Play Park in Fife  see  my indoor playground list for more options.

Play to Learn at the South Hill Library  Special program for children up to 6  and caregivers. Play, songs, stories. Drop-in 1:30

Pajama Family Story Time in Renton 7PM  Scroll to the date for the listing; I regret that I can’t seem to link to individual events in the KCLS.

Tuesday

Block Play at the Fife Library at 10 or Key Center at 11

It’s 1.00 day at the Starplex in Federal Way! Tickets are just 2.00 other days. Small upcharge for 3D Choices include Wreck it Ralph and the Rise of the Guardians

 Celebrate International Children’s Day in Fife at 4:30  Make a Pinata!

Lego Club at the Auburn Library  Kids 5-12 are invited to join Bricks 4 Kidz. Registration is required; limited to 20 children. 4:30 Scroll to the date for the listing; I regret that I can’t seem to link to individual events in the KCLS.

Wednesday

Tot Time at Learning Sprout Toys in Tacoma  Always a good idea to confirm first 10:30

It’s Free Day at the White River Valley Museum in Auburn(Admission is just 2.00/1.00 other days). Small, but kid friendly

Play to Learn at the Parkland/Spanway Library at 10 or Graham at 1:30 Special program for children up to 6  and caregivers. Play, songs, stories. Drop-in 1:30

Wacky Wednesdays at the South Hill Library  2PM School age kids 6-12 are invited to drop in and do some Lego!

Art After School in Steilacoom  For school age kids  All supplies provided!

Read to a Dog in Sumner 4PM

 May Day Celebration in Tacoma  Head to Fireman’s park to make a flower crown and sing and dance! 6PM

Juice and Jammies story time at the Olympia Barnes and Noble 7PM

Thursday

Play to Learn at the Lakewood Library at 10 or Graham at 1:30 Special program for children up to 6  and caregivers. Play, songs, stories. Drop-in 1:30

Westfield Family Fun Day at Southcenter  10AM  Arts and crafts, snacks from Auntie Anne’s and more!

Indoor Toddler Play Park in Fife  See this my indoor playground list for more options.

The Broadway Farmer’s Market Opens!

Friday

Members Only Preview of the New Stingray Cove at the Point Defiance Zoo

Read to a Dog in Sumner at 4PM

 Put Your Rhythm On at the Auburn Library  Special, multicultural program of song and dance for kids with rhythm and music from Cuba and Brazil 4:30 -Scroll to the date for the listing; I regret that I can’t seem to link to individual events in the KCLS.

Parent’s Night Out at the Children’s Museum of Tacoma

Free first Friday at the Hands-on Children’s Museum in Olympia  Did you see my post on how you can go free with a pass from the Timberland Regional Library System?
